    Sarkodie pledges star-studded lineup for next ‘Rapperholic’ concert

    Rapper Sarkodie has hinted at featuring some A-list musicians in his next Rapperholic concert.

    In an interview shared via social media on September 29, 2025, Sarkodie noted that it is his utmost desire to have artistes such as Stonebwoy, R2Bees, and Shatta Wale on the same stage in the next concert.

    “If I can get Sarkodie, Shatta Wale, Stonebwoy, R2Bees, and some Nigerian artistes during Rapperholic, I will be okay. Every artiste in Ghana has been on Rapperholic apart from the late Daddy Lumba,” he said.

    Sarkodie further addressed an ongoing conversation on social media, where some netizens have accused Stonebwoy of disassociating himself from the concert.

    In response, he explained that he could not bring every artiste in the country on stage, and therefore urged Ghanaians to be patient and look forward to Stonebwoy’s appearance next year.

    “All fans in Bhim Nation should be calm because next year we will reach out to Stonebwoy. This year, I didn’t do a lot of outreach because there is a lot of cost involved in bringing everyone.

    “Shatta Wale came in as a sponsor, I even came here with his car. Assuming he had asked me to sponsor his trip to Kumasi, I am not sure I could provide,” he added.
